Development Update: Tuesday, March 21
By The Futon Critic Staff (TFC)

LOS ANGELES (thefutoncritic.com) -- The latest development news, culled from recent wire reports:

ALTERED CARBON (Netflix) - Adam Busch will recur on the upcoming sci-fi drama as Mickey, "a brilliant, acerbic computer technician working for the Bay City Police Department. Despite his sarcastic, often biting demeanor, he is unquestioningly loyal to his friends in blue and will do anything to help them track a killer." (Deadline.com)
BATES MOTEL (A&E) - Natalia Cordova-Buckley will recur on the show's final season as Julia Ramos, "a world-weary and efficient high-powered attorney who typically represents guys from the drug business. Sharp as a tack, Julia is described as a seasoned professional who cuts right to the chase." (Variety.com)
CHI, THE (Showtime) - Jahking Guillory is bound for the newcomer as Coogie: "Frequently in and out of trouble, the charismatic Coogie has a wry sense of humor and a penchant for mischief." (Deadline.com)
DYNASTY (The CW) - Brianna Brown will guest on the netlet's reboot of the iconic drama as the "off-kilter" Claudia. (TVLine.com)
FARGO (FX) - Olivia Sandoval will recur on the upcoming season as St. Cloud police officer Winnie Lopez: "Blessed with the gift of gab, Winnie is not shy about sharing her feelings on everything from family planning to being a female on the force." (Deadline.com)
GET, THE (CBS) - Amy Brenneman has been tapped for the lead role on the drama pilot as Ellen Sullivan, "an investigative journalist for The Get who has been known to push boundaries in order to find the truth." (Deadline.com)
HANNAH ROYCE'S QUESTIONABLE CHOICES (CBS) - Kyle Howard is set to star opposite Alice Eve in the comedy pilot as Lewis, "Hannah's second husband and the father of her middle child, Carter." (Deadline.com)
LAS REINAS (ABC) - Shalim Ortiz has joined the cast of the Daniella Alonso-led drama as Diego de la Reina, "Alex's brother. Diego has grown up under his grandmother's supervision and enjoys the power and prestige of being a de la Reina. When he sees his sister again after years of estrangement, they clash over her re-appearance and his increasing role in the crime family." (Deadline.com)
LOS HERMANOS (Showtime, New!) - Hayes Davenport has sold a new comedy to the pay channel about "two brothers from Chula Vista, California - a town close to the U.S. Mexican border near San Diego - who start an unconventional business together to pay for their mom's healthcare." Kapital Entertainment's Aaron Kaplan and Dana Honor also serve as executive producers. (Deadline.com)
MISSION CONTROL (CBS) - Ricardo Chavira has signed onto the drama pilot as Fulgencio Diaz, "director of the Johnson Space Center." He'll replace Nestor Serrano, who originally was cast in the role. (Deadline.com)
PATH, THE (Hulu) - Co-executive producer Annie Weisman has signed a two-year overall deal with producer Universal Television. (Deadline.com)
PHILIP K. DICK'S ELECTRIC DREAMS (Amazon) - Timothy Spall (Mr. Turner) is set to star in the debut installment of the anthology series as Ed Jacobson, "an unassuming employee at a train station who is alarmed to discover that a number of daily commuters are taking the train to a town that shouldn't exist. When he investigates for himself, he comes face to face with an alternate reality that forces him to confront his own struggles around his relationship with his wife Mary (Rebecca Manley) and his very troubled son Sam (Anthony Boyle)." Tom Harper is directing from a script by Jack Thorne. (Deadline.com)
RESIDENT, THE (FOX) - Valerie Cruz has scored a role on the drama pilot as hospital CEO Renata Lopez. (Deadline.com)
SALVATION (CBS) - Dennis Boutsikaris and Aaron Poole are both bound for the summer series. Boutsikaris will play Dr. Malcolm Croft, "Liam's (Charlie Rowe) professor and mentor at MIT. When Liam shows up at his house in the middle of the night with an urgent discovery, Croft at first is dismissive. But after a further look at Liam's findings, he realizes that the young prodigy has discovered something that could change the course of human history, and there's little time to act." Poole then is set as Lazlo, "a childhood friend of Darius (Santiago Cabrera). Despite a long, complicated history together, Lazlo is Darius's head of security and trusted fixer." (Deadline.com)
UNTITLED SEAL TEAM 6 PROJECT (CBS) - Ed Redlich has been tapped as showrunner of the drama pilot, which follows the lives of the elite Navy SEALs as they train, plan and execute the most dangerous, high stakes missions our country can ask. (Deadline.com)
